Factors to Look for When Choosing a Women Insurance Plan in Singapore
A women insurance plan addresses the unique health concerns that women face through different stages of their life. You want a plan that safeguards your health and financial well-being in the long run. But how do you select a women insurance plan that is right for you and meets your requirements? This article will discuss a factors you should consider when selecting a women insurance plan that will suit your unique needs.
· Coverage for Women-Specific Illnesses:
One of the main reasons to choose a women insurance plan is that it provides coverage for illnesses that mainly affect women. These illnesses include breast cancer, cervical cancer, and other gynaecological conditions. You must check the illnesses that are covered in your plan when selecting an insurance plan for yourself. Some plans can include other benefits, such as reconstructive surgery and post-diagnostic support. Such plans are crucial as they provide time for recovery and peace of mind.
· Preventive Health Screening:
Preventive care is important for early detection and management
of health issues. Various women insurance plans offer regular health screenings
as part of their policy. Health screenings and regular check-ups can help
identify irregularities early, leading to prompt treatment. Irregularities like
breast lumps, cervical abnormalities, and other health conditions can be
detected early before they get worse. Look for plans that include comprehensive
preventive health screenings at regular intervals, such as every one or two
years. This feature can help you stay proactive about your well-being and
identify issues before they become serious.
·
Maternity and Pregnancy Coverage:
Maternity and pregnancy coverage is a top priority for those who
are planning to have children or may become pregnant in the future. Various
women insurance plans provide add-ons that cover pregnancy. These plans also
include benefits for complications during pregnancy, congenital illnesses, and
hospital care for both mother and child. These can provide peace of mind and
financial protection during one of the most joyous moments of your life.
·
Premium Waivers:
Thinking of insurance premiums is the last thought on one’s mind
when you are dealing with a serious illness. Some women insurance plans
understand the challenges you go through when diagnosed with a critical illness
and offer premium waivers. It means that you will not have to pay insurance
premiums for a specific period. It can typically last up to 36 months. This benefit
can lessen your financial burden, giving you time to focus on your recovery and
not the expenses.
·
Flexibility and Customisation:
Every woman has different health needs, and your insurance plan
should be able to address that. You should look for a plan that provides
flexibility and customisation options. You should have the option of adding on
coverage for specific needs or choosing from different levels of coverage to
suit your health requirements. Being able to tailor your coverage means that
you can make sure you have the coverage you need without paying for unnecessary
extra options.
